吉林大學2023年研究生考試軟體專碩967

2021-09-28 02:16:46 字數 1346 閱讀 7014

//編寫乙個程式,對輸入的任意字串,統計並輸出其中每個英文小寫字母在該字串**現的次數

思想:此題簡單,主要是是輸出字元對應的陣列的元素值時,需要用到ascall

#include#include#include#define n 100

void count(char arr,int time)

}}int main()

}return 0;}二

//有整數文法的定義如下,編寫程式實現,對於給定的任意的串符合上述文法,則輸出;若不是,則輸出錯誤

//註解;此題判斷給的字串是否是數字字元,編譯原理

思想: 用char型別的陣列str接受字串,遍歷字串,如不出現出數字外的其他字元,則正確。

#include#include#include#define n 50

int jude(char str)

return 1;

}int main()

第三題;

//螺旋矩陣是證書的一種排列方式。程式設計實現10x10的螺旋矩陣

//此題對於我來說太難了,看了大神的之後,恍然大悟,如夢初醒。

//可以肯定的是,考試現場的我肯定做不出來

#include#include#define m 10

int main()

//保持列不變,行變。向上順序加一

for (i = t - 2; i>m - t; i--)

//向內縮一圈

t--;

}for (i = 0; i#include#include#define n 6 //集合元素的總個數

#define m 2 //子集元素的個數

int main()

; //定義二進位制陣列

int bin[n] = ;

int i,n,j,k;

//n位的二進位制數字,共有2^n個,迴圈2^n遍,每次 bin[0]+1

for (i = 0; i < pow(2, n); i++)

//遍歷二進位制陣列,統計二進位制陣列中值為1的個數

for (j = 0; j < n; j++)

//如果n=m,則達到規定的子集資料元素個數,此時輸出

if (n == m)

else}}

printf("} ");}}

return 0;

}附上求乙個集合的子集**

#include#include#define len 11

int set[len]=;

int main()

{ int n,t,i;

int temp;

scanf("%d",&n);

if(n>0&&n

吉林大學2023年研究生考試軟體專碩967

2017年967 1 驗證角谷猜想 對任何乙個大於0的正整數n,1 若是偶數,則將其除以2 2 若是奇數,則將其乘以 3再加以1 得到的新數字重複上述步驟,若干次會得到1 計算變換的次數 includemain else count printf d需經過 d步才得到1.b,count 2 設有字串...

2023年西安交通大學915研究生考試程式設計題真題

西安交通大學2021年研究生考試915計算機軟體基礎 含資料結構 程式設計 有3道程式設計題,整體難度不難,也可以說偏簡單。但有部分考生因為前面的題目花了太多時間,導致沒有寫完程式設計題,或者慣性思維覺得最後一題一定很難,就放棄了。應用題 解答題是難點,題量大,要求對知識點把握很深。需要強調的是,今...

Python 2023年北航研究生入學考試機試題

問題描述 某些整數能分解成若干個連續整數的和的形式,例如 15 1 2 3 4 5 15 4 5 6 15 7 8 某些整數不能分解為連續整數的和,例如 16 輸入形式 乙個整數n n 10000 輸出形式 整數n對應的所有分解組合,如果沒有任何分解組合,則輸出none。樣例輸入 15 樣例輸出 1...